Braydon Wilson’s parents adopted him and his twin brother, Dallas, and Jace when they were seven. Diagnosed with schizophrenia when he was a teen, Braydon has had to navigate his mental illness with the help of his family, his childhood sweetheart, and a therapist.
When Braydon switches therapists after his baseball coach pressures him, things take a chilling turn between him and his therapist. Braydon’s new therapist causes mass destruction for Braydon, his family, and his childhood sweetheart.
Emerald Prescott has loved Braydon Wilson since she was thirteen. She has been there for him through his diagnosis and baseball career. When their relationship implodes, it leaves Emerald heartbroken and Braydon confused. She returns home and must pick up the pieces after a devastating heartbreak.
When Bradley and Hazel travel to bring Dallas and Braydon home, they’ll need to make sense of the events that transpired. With the help of Braydon’s family and his former therapist, Jayden Harper, the Wilson family will discover that not everyone has ethical intentions.
Braydon will navigate a tremendous betrayal to reclaim his life, his relationship with Emerald, and his family. Sometimes, it’s the people we trust with our health who turn out to be our greatest betrayers.
